Savannah Guthrie recently revealed that her love story with husband Michael Feldman had a dramatic twist before their engagement.
During an appearance on The Kelly Clarkson Show, the TODAY show anchor shared that she actually broke up with Feldman on the very day he planned to propose.
The couple had been dating for over five years, and Guthrie admitted she was growing impatient, wondering if marriage was ever in their future.
During a romantic getaway to Turks and Caicos, she decided she couldn’t wait any longer and told Feldman it was time to part ways.
What she didn’t know at the time was that he had an engagement ring in his pocket, ready to propose later that day.
The Unexpected Breakup Before the Proposal
Guthrie met Feldman, a former Democratic political adviser, at his 40th birthday party, which she attended as a guest of a friend. The two quickly connected and began dating after he reached out via email a few days later. However, after dating for five and a half years without a proposal, Guthrie started to question whether their relationship was heading toward marriage.
She explained on the talk show that her own mother had encouraged her to make a decision, advising, “You need to either do it or don’t.” Feeling that time was slipping away, Guthrie decided to take matters into her own hands. While in Turks and Caicos, she told Feldman she loved him but couldn’t continue waiting indefinitely. “Let’s just say goodbye. Let’s just let each other go,” she recalled saying to him.
Despite her emotional decision, Feldman urged her to still enjoy their vacation together. Guthrie described feeling “weepy” throughout the day, second-guessing whether breaking up was the right choice.
A Surprise Proposal at Sunset
What Guthrie didn’t realize was that Feldman had secretly planned to propose during the trip. He had not told anyone—not friends, not family—so he easily could have walked away without revealing his intentions. But instead of giving up, he made a last-minute decision that would change everything.
As the sun began to set, Feldman suggested they enjoy some champagne that the resort had sent them. Guthrie, believing they were going their separate ways, wanted to have one last drink together. She had no idea what was coming next.
As they sat down, Feldman got down on one knee and popped the question. Guthrie admitted she was so stunned that she didn’t immediately understand what was happening. “I honestly didn’t understand that was what the question was,” she said. But once it sank in, she was overwhelmed with joy. “It was so shocking to me and I was so happy.”
A Happily Ever After
One year after their engagement, Guthrie and Feldman tied the knot in March 2014 just outside her hometown of Tucson, Arizona. Their wedding was a beautiful celebration of their love, marking the official start of their life together as husband and wife.
Five months later, the couple welcomed their first child, daughter Vale Guthrie Feldman, on August 13, 2014. Two years later, their family grew again when their son, Charles Max, was born on December 8, 2016.
